Merge master.
authorCarl Hetherington <cth@carlh.net>
Wed, 6 Aug 2014 14:37:57 +0000 (15:37 +0100)
committerCarl Hetherington <cth@carlh.net>
Wed, 6 Aug 2014 14:37:57 +0000 (15:37 +0100)
1  2 
ChangeLog
cscript
src/lib/config.cc
src/lib/config.h
src/lib/kdm.cc
src/wx/about_dialog.cc
src/wx/config_dialog.cc

diff --cc ChangeLog
index 0a1f804b93789b8ac1ad807443f0ba0f33ea22d1,884f384bbb7350c600b8baea8746da750199ddba..d25196832ee9985848b7f841895e5398dfd4f16d
+++ b/ChangeLog
@@@ -1,17 -1,11 +1,25 @@@
 +2014-07-15  Carl Hetherington  <cth@carlh.net>
 +
 +      * A variety of changes were made on the 2.0 branch
 +      but not documented in the ChangeLog.  Most sigificantly:
 +
 +      - DCP import
 +      - Creation of DCPs with proper XML subtitles
 +      - Import of .srt and .xml subtitles
 +      - Audio processing framework (with some basic processors).
 +
 +2014-03-07  Carl Hetherington  <cth@carlh.net>
 +
 +      * Add subtitle view.
 +
+ 2014-08-04  Carl Hetherington  <cth@carlh.net>
+       * Add BCC option for KDM emails.
+ 2014-07-29  Carl Hetherington  <cth@carlh.net>
+       * Version 1.72.5 released.
  2014-07-17  Carl Hetherington  <cth@carlh.net>
  
        * Fix corrupted text in job descriptions in some cases.
diff --cc cscript
Simple merge
Simple merge
index d8ac75beddd48e79fc98b3653d9f75f6c1b15c96,0ce6b8351a4b0a48d5fb3a0791112edd5edd2ba1..310d3c6f5e2ca4624761c1b22ab44fa95e85ebc6
@@@ -461,10 -445,8 +470,11 @@@ private
        std::string _kdm_subject;
        std::string _kdm_from;
        std::string _kdm_cc;
+       std::string _kdm_bcc;
        std::string _kdm_email;
 +      boost::shared_ptr<const dcp::Signer> _signer;
 +      dcp::Certificate _decryption_certificate;
 +      std::string _decryption_private_key;
        /** true to check for updates on startup */
        bool _check_for_updates;
        bool _check_for_test_updates;
diff --cc src/lib/kdm.cc
Simple merge
Simple merge
index 8e27dc540856829651788014866674e54a335112,234ac319dfa0947068083c3f666cd33a3c126b96..175ed94ade131a754781e69476f9d6d6f4f3a534
@@@ -1006,9 -697,13 +1006,13 @@@ public
                add_label_to_sizer (table, panel, _("CC address"), true);
                _kdm_cc = new wxTextCtrl (panel, wxID_ANY);
                table->Add (_kdm_cc, 1, wxEXPAND | wxALL);
+               add_label_to_sizer (table, panel, _("BCC address"), true);
+               _kdm_bcc = new wxTextCtrl (panel, wxID_ANY);
+               table->Add (_kdm_bcc, 1, wxEXPAND | wxALL);
                
                _kdm_email = new wxTextCtrl (panel, wxID_ANY, wxEmptyString, wxDefaultPosition, wxSize (480, 128), wxTE_MULTILINE);
 -              s->Add (_kdm_email, 1.5, wxEXPAND | wxALL, _border);
 +              s->Add (_kdm_email, 1, wxEXPAND | wxALL, _border);
  
                _reset_kdm_email = new wxButton (panel, wxID_ANY, _("Reset to default text"));
                s->Add (_reset_kdm_email, 0, wxEXPAND | wxALL, _border);